Elephant Castle Toronto
NOW CLOSED

Elephant & Castle Yonge and Gerrard

Elephant & Castle is a pseudo British pub where you can find decent fish and chips and a predictable, if extensive, beer list.


Latest Videos



Latest Reviews

Balam Toronto

Himalayan Momo House

Bar Prima

Hot Pork

Comma

BeLeaf